summaryrefslogtreecommitdiff
path: root/src/CMakeLists.txt
diff options
context:
space:
mode:
authorHans Erik van Elburg <hanserik@vanelburg.net>2015-01-03 23:35:39 +0100
committerHans Erik van Elburg <hanserik@vanelburg.net>2015-01-03 23:35:39 +0100
commit93c55c5ec6db6bce3173204f6a62ab5b2b8afde1 (patch)
tree11184f4c379b30ab98d60338b698db3a0813626b /src/CMakeLists.txt
parent617be983b9d9afd67dd1752f3331f02a4450361e (diff)
downloadfork-ledger-93c55c5ec6db6bce3173204f6a62ab5b2b8afde1.tar.gz
fork-ledger-93c55c5ec6db6bce3173204f6a62ab5b2b8afde1.tar.bz2
fork-ledger-93c55c5ec6db6bce3173204f6a62ab5b2b8afde1.zip
also added cygwin tweak to src/CMakeLists.txt
Diffstat (limited to 'src/CMakeLists.txt')
-rw-r--r--src/CMakeLists.txt14
1 files changed, 12 insertions, 2 deletions
di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t
index aec75c06..dcafeba2 100644
--- a/src/CMakeLists.txt
+++ b/src/CMakeLists.txt
@@ -167,7 +167,12 @@ if (CMAKE_BUILD_TYPE STREQUAL "Debug")
if (BUILD_LIBRARY)
list(APPEND _args ${CMAKE_SHARED_LIBRARY_CXX_FLAGS})
endif()
- list(APPEND _args "-std=c++11 ")
+ if (CYGWIN)
+ list(APPEND _args "-std=c++11 ")
+ list(APPEND _args "-U__STRICT_ANSI__")
+ else()
+ list(APPEND _args "-std=c++11 ")
+ endif()
list(APPEND _args "-x c++-header " ${_inc})
list(APPEND _args -c ${_header_filename} -o ${_pch_filename})
@@ -223,7 +228,12 @@ if (CMAKE_BUILD_TYPE STREQUAL "Debug")
list(APPEND _args ${CMAKE_SHARED_LIBRARY_CXX_FLAGS})
endif()
list(APPEND _args ${GXX_WARNING_FLAGS})
- list(APPEND _args "-std=c++11 ")
+ if (CYGWIN)
+ list(APPEND _args "-std=c++11 ")
+ list(APPEND _args "-U__STRICT_ANSI__")
+ else()
+ list(APPEND _args "-std=c++11 ")
+ endif()
list(APPEND _args "-x c++-header " ${_inc})
list(APPEND _args -c ${_header_filename} -o ${_gch_filename})